64x32 RGB LED Matrix - 2.5mm pitch

2048-pixel RGB LED matrix panel, 64x32 at 2.5 mm pitch, with dual IDC connectors for chaining. Requires 13 digital pins and a 5V supply; finest pitch in the 64x32 series.

Pinout

  • R1

    Upper-half red data input on the RGB matrix input connector. Adafruit Learn describes R1/G1/B1 as the upper RGB data signals.

    Type · signal
  • G1

    Upper-half green data input on the RGB matrix input connector. Adafruit Learn describes R1/G1/B1 as the upper RGB data signals.

    Type · signal
  • B1

    Upper-half blue data input on the RGB matrix input connector. Adafruit Learn describes R1/G1/B1 as the upper RGB data signals.

    Type · signal
  • R2

    Lower-half red data input on the RGB matrix input connector. Adafruit Learn describes R2/G2/B2 as the lower RGB data signals.

    Type · signal
  • G2

    Lower-half green data input on the RGB matrix input connector. Adafruit Learn describes R2/G2/B2 as the lower RGB data signals.

    Type · signal

B2

Lower-half blue data input on the RGB matrix input connector. Adafruit Learn describes R2/G2/B2 as the lower RGB data signals.

Type · signal
  • A

    Row-address input. Adafruit Learn lists A/B/C/D as shared address signals for RGB matrix panels.

    Type · signal
  • B

    Row-address input. Adafruit Learn lists A/B/C/D as shared address signals for RGB matrix panels.

    Type · signal
  • C

    Row-address input. Adafruit Learn lists A/B/C/D as shared address signals for RGB matrix panels.

    Type · signal
  • D

    Row-address input used on larger panels. Adafruit Learn lists A/B/C/D as shared address signals for RGB matrix panels.

    Type · signal
  • CLK

    Pixel clock input for shifting RGB data into the panel. Adafruit Learn lists CLK as a shared matrix control signal.

    Type · signal
  • LAT / STB

    Latch/strobe input. Adafruit Learn notes LAT may be labelled STB on some panels.

    Type · signal
  • OE

    Output-enable control input. Adafruit Learn lists OE as a shared matrix control signal.

    Type · signal
  • 5V

    Panel power input for the 64x32 RGB LED matrix; the Adafruit product/listing is a 5 V RGB LED matrix panel.

    Type · powerVoltage · 5 V panel power
  • GND

    Ground return for panel power and logic reference.

    Type · powerVoltage · 0 V
